Lines Matching defs:nval
682 uint32_t oval, nval;
687 if ((nval = oval + 1) == 0) {
702 nval = 1;
704 } while (dtrace_cas32(counter, oval, nval) != oval);
2340 dtrace_aggregate_min(uint64_t *oval, uint64_t nval, uint64_t arg)
2342 if ((int64_t)nval < (int64_t)*oval)
2343 *oval = nval;
2348 dtrace_aggregate_max(uint64_t *oval, uint64_t nval, uint64_t arg)
2350 if ((int64_t)nval > (int64_t)*oval)
2351 *oval = nval;
2355 dtrace_aggregate_quantize(uint64_t *quanta, uint64_t nval, uint64_t incr)
2358 int64_t val = (int64_t)nval;
2383 dtrace_aggregate_lquantize(uint64_t *lquanta, uint64_t nval, uint64_t incr)
2389 int32_t val = (int32_t)nval, level;
2472 dtrace_aggregate_llquantize(uint64_t *llquanta, uint64_t nval, uint64_t incr)
2481 low, high, nsteps, nval)] += incr;
2486 dtrace_aggregate_avg(uint64_t *data, uint64_t nval, uint64_t arg)
2489 data[1] += nval;
2494 dtrace_aggregate_stddev(uint64_t *data, uint64_t nval, uint64_t arg)
2496 int64_t snval = (int64_t)nval;
2500 data[1] += nval;
2505 * data[2] += nval * nval;
2507 * But given that nval is 64-bit, we could easily overflow, so
2519 dtrace_aggregate_count(uint64_t *oval, uint64_t nval, uint64_t arg)
2526 dtrace_aggregate_sum(uint64_t *oval, uint64_t nval, uint64_t arg)
2528 *oval += nval;